The two-act banking crisis that unfolded in March and April generated fears for the insurance sector from asset portfolio hits and D&O/E&O losses, as well as the indirect income from the macroeconomic shock.

However, in fact, the sector’s biggest Achilles heel was arguably a relatively low-profile part of the US surety market that would in the eventuality of deposit defaults have generated a multi-billion insured loss.
